Post by Retrovision on Oct 30, 2006 22:47:02 GMT -8
I have not voted for my own, but have chosen #12 instead. Obvoiously I like this shot, but, I would like to ask the photographer... How did two PR class come to be simultaneously in that location off of Sturdies Bay? I need an explanation, as I am inclined to think that some photoshopping is possible here? There are two ways that is a possible sight once a year for a period of time each... 1. As when the picture was taken, the Bowen Queen was on her regular summer route of 9a, Tsawwassen - SGI. 2. As just ended on Friday for this year's refit of the Queen of Cumberland, when the Bowen Queen is filling-in on route 5, alongside the Mayne Queen, who's regularly on route 5 in the Gulf Islands and based out of Swartz Bay.
